old 2AA minimag. I got this in ~1997 as a gift from my steel supplier when I was employed as a quality engineer in the automotive industry. Its the only light I own that can be completely taken apart and serviced down to the last piece part. One time I dropped it and the small metal contact piece at the end of the body tube got bent somehow. I just bent it back and its good to go.

I like the size and shape of the bezel much more than the current crop of MAG-leds.

Needs a new lens though, the OEM one is really scratched from all the use over the decade.
If these guys can make this level of quality in America for $9.... why can't anyone else?

I currently have three MagLites: a black non-"D" serial number 2D, a light blue "D" serial number 2D, and a silver Mini-MagLite.

The light blue MagLite is my current favorite and it was given to me by my cousin after his father passed away. It was his dad's light but it wasn't working when he gave it to me. I put a fresh set of batteries in it and it worked but by the next morning it was dead again. I decided to buy a MagLED module for my black 2D but put it into the blue light, first, probably because it was sitting there looking pathetic to me. To my surprise, that little LED lit right up when I hit the button! Thinking that the bulb was bad I placed the old bulb into my black 2D to test it and it worked fine. Put it back into the blue 2D and nothing. That's when I figured that there was an internal short of some kind that was allowing the batteries to drain overnight but not enough to light the filament. That MagLED module has stayed in that light ever since. I've recently replaced the Luxeon LED with an SSC P4 and it is much brighter now, brighter than the black 2D with Xenon bulb and fresh batteries!
